Subject: On-call handover — Lumora SDK parity

Hi Priya,

Handing over the Lumora client SDK parity work. The Kotlin SDK now supports batched telemetry, but the Swift SDK is still two releases behind — retry backoff and offline queueing are missing. The parity matrix lives in the Driftboard wiki under "SDK Parity Q3." Please don't ship the Swift beta until queueing lands; partners at Ostrel Labs depend on it. Since you're new as a contractor, flag anything ambiguous early. Questions about the parity matrix should go to the address below.

alerts address for bafog-tawep: ulavan_sorwyn_fraax@kelviworks.local

Hey — quick handover on the LinguaPull extraction script. It scans the Fernhollow app repos, pulls translatable strings, and pushes them to the Phrasebin queue before each release cut. Run it after feature freeze, not before. Flaky on merge commits, just rerun. Questions about edge cases go straight to the maintainer.

named custodian: Brivan Eliath Quenox Frador

☐ Step 7 — Date localization check. Before sealing the Varnholt signing keys, confirm the ceremony log renders dates in ISO 8601 regardless of the operator's locale. The Kestrelgate console defaults to regional formats, which has caused audit mismatches before. Once verified, unlock the escrow module using the passphrase below.

recovery phrase for bawef-haduf: wenax-druox-julmir